| Parameter | Specification Details |
|---|---|
| Standard Configurations | SpO2, PR, NIBP, ECG, RESP, TEMP |
| Target Species | Feline, Canine, Equine, Bovine, etc. (Small to Large Animals) |
| Physical Dimensions | Compact & Portable: Approx. 13 cm × 8 cm × 5 cm |
| Interface & Control | Intuitive One-Button Operation UI with clear data display |
